The original V mini-series was awesome, and was actually a very powerful commentary on the ability of charismatic leaders to influence the masses with hollow promises and powerful words. The story very closely paralleled the rise of the Nazi party in pre-WW2 Germany, which was done on purpose, and had many interesting twists that built the tension slowly. From recruiting human teenagers into their ranks, much like the Hitler Youth, to focusing their propaganda to isolate one subsection of the population, in this case scientists, they showed how rational individuals can be caught up in a movement and do things that they would normally find reprehensible. Honestly, the original miniseries didn't even need the lizard bit to be an excellent story.

Unfortunately, the TV series that followed did not live up to the potential of the original. I remember watching every episode of the one season of the TV series, and even as a kid (I was probably ten or eleven at the time) I could tell that it just wasn't that good. I was still a fan, mind you, but I knew that it wasn't what it could be. Watching it through the eyes of an adult, a couple weeks ago, I realized that the show was one of those that you can enjoy for it's sheer badness, from terrible acting to inconsistent plotlines, but it is sadly disappointing as a followup to such a great miniseries.
